The "OG" (Old Goat) Aged Goat Cheese

"Trader Joe’s The “OG” (Old Goat) Aged Goat Cheese is not made from milk that comes from elderly goats. The name’s nod to maturity actually refers to the fact that it’s Aged for at least ten months. Over this extended period of time, The Old Goat rests on untreated wooden shelves. The porous quality of the wood helps regulate moisture within the Cheese while fostering the development of beneficial microflora, resulting in a more complex flavor profile than that of its fresh goat cheese brethren.
However, it’s not just the aging that’s responsible for our April Spotlight Cheese’s champion character. You’ll also delight in its firm “paste,” in contrast to the softer, often spreadable forms of chèvre that one more commonly associates with goat’s milk cheese. (Our Chevre with Honey comes to mind.) While this “hard” texture is less common, the overall flavor of The “OG” should be more of what you’re expecting. Its burst of piquant flavor is delicious sliced thin and served on TJ’s crackers; grated over a plate of steaming pasta; or simply cubed and enjoyed one bite after another!
